I want to scale the geom_line chart so that the area chart looks like this image (example). In my example I was able to scale both Y-axes but geom_line does not obey the second Y-axis. enter image description here

This is my code

library(ggplot2)

df <- read.csv("route/file.csv")
gas <- as.data.frame(df[, 1:3])

ggplot(gas) +
  geom_area(aes(x = año, y = qg, fill = " Qg [MMMpc]"),
            colour = "#ffed63", alpha = 0.9) +
  geom_line(aes(x = año, y = np, colour = "Gp [MMMpc]"),
            linewidth=1, linetype = "dashed")+
  scale_colour_manual(values = "#C5B21D")+
  scale_fill_manual(values = "#ffed63")+
  guides(colour = guide_legend(override.aes = list(fill = "black"))) +
  scale_x_continuous(breaks = gas$año) +
  scale_y_continuous(breaks = seq(0, 60, 10),
                     limits = c(0, 180),
                     sec.axis = sec_axis(trans = ~ .*3,
                                         breaks = seq(0, 180, 30),
                                         labels = seq(0, 180, 30),
                                         name = "Total acumulado [MMMpc]")))

    secondary axes in ggplot2 are just decorations -- everything is mapped based on the primary axis and nothing will "obey" the 2nd axis. You probably need `geom_line(aes(x = año, y = np/3 ...` – Jon Spring Jun 21 '23 at 18:06
